As part of its community relations and collaborative engagements, the new Management Team of Ritman University, led by the Vice-Chancellor, Professor Akan B. Williams, has paid a courtesy visit to the Area Commander, Ikot Ekpene Area Command, and the Divisional Police Officer (DPO), Ikot Ekpene Division.
The visit, held on 4th October, 2025, was aimed at strengthening partnership and fostering continuous cooperation between the University and the Nigeria Police Force in ensuring a safe and peaceful environment conducive for teaching, learning, and community development.
In his remarks, the Vice-Chancellor, Professor Akan Williams, expressed profound appreciation to the Police Command for their sustained support and vigilance towards maintaining peace and order within the University and its host community. He reiterated the institution’s commitment to maintaining an open and cordial working relationship with the security agencies.
According to him, “Ritman University values the role of the Police in safeguarding lives and property. We look forward to deepening our collaboration in areas of community safety, youth mentorship, and civic education.”
Responding, the Area Commander, ACP. Adamu Gamji, commended the leadership of Ritman University for the visit and described it as a demonstration of responsible partnership. He assured the University of the Command’s readiness to continue supporting its security architecture and initiatives geared toward the wellbeing of students and staff.
Similarly, The Officers acknowledged the positive relationship between the institution and the Division, promising to further strengthen ties through proactive policing and continuous communication.
The Vice-Chancellor was accompanied by Chief Security Officer, as well as the information Officer of the University.
The visit ended on a note of mutual appreciation and reaffirmation of the shared commitment between Ritman University and the Nigeria Police Force to promote peace, safety, and sustainable collaboration within the Ikot Ekpene community.
